    The 32 bytes sig is composed of two 128 bits keys :
    - the BIT key (first 16 bytes)
    - the content key (last 16 bytes)

    I've learned other things, but i must be sure before to report

    when i was comparing two copies of [supposedly] the same file, one encrypted for us, one for eur there was a block of similar data in the middle.

    every couple hundreds of bytes there was 8byte block that differed for two files, and the last 32 or 64 bytes were different. hmm, you could be right there. (there could be checksums at certain points in the encrypted files as well - i don't know what are they for, so that's my guess)

    still my theory about file length composed of two header fields was a pretty much wild guess (since i tested it on ~6 files ), so no worries if you post your wild guesses as well ;-)

    Your right yoshi for the two hex sections about file size.
    From what i've seen from my eyes it 's not just theory, it's a sure thing.

    The first 32 bit is data lenght.
    The second 16 bit is header length.

    File header also have flags...
